Bitcoin Must Maintain Key Level for Analyst’s Bullish Outlook in June 2025

Bitcoin is showing an unexpected vigor this summer, with analysts eyeing a critical price threshold that could pave the way for further gains. As of June 2025, Bitcoin’s resilience is surprising many, driven by fresh capital inflows that have breathed new life into what was anticipated to be a subdued trading season.

A Surge Fueled by New Capital

In recent weeks, Bitcoin has defied expectations, bolstered by a wave of new investments. This influx has provided a buoyancy that analysts believe could sustain upward momentum, provided a key price level holds firm. “We’ve seen a notable increase in institutional interest,” says Alex Chen, a senior analyst at CryptoInsights. “This isn’t just retail optimism—big players are stepping in, which changes the game entirely.”

Yet, it’s not just institutional investors who are fueling this rally. Retail investors, too, are returning to the fray, lured by Bitcoin’s potential as a hedge against inflation. With inflationary pressures still a concern globally, Bitcoin’s appeal as a store of value remains compelling. The Critical Threshold

The magic number on everyone’s lips is $45,000. This price point is widely regarded as a psychological and technical barrier that could open the floodgates for Bitcoin’s next leg up. “Breaking and sustaining above $45,000 would be crucial,” explains market strategist Jenna Lee. “It would signify not just technical strength, but also reinforce investor confidence.”

However, Bitcoin’s path is never linear. Volatility remains an inherent characteristic of the cryptocurrency market, and while the current trajectory is positive, caution is warranted. Historical Context and Market Dynamics

Bitcoin’s current performance is reminiscent of its behavior in previous bull markets, where unexpected catalysts have sparked rapid gains. Historically, these rallies have been accompanied by increased media attention and speculative fervor, often leading to heightened volatility. It’s a pattern seasoned traders know all too well—momentum can be both a friend and a foe.

The current landscape is also shaped by technological advancements within the crypto ecosystem. Innovations in decentralized finance (DeFi) and the growing importance of Ethereum’s transition to a proof-of-stake model have broadened the market’s appeal. These developments contribute to a more mature and diverse digital asset environment, attracting a broader range of investors.
